US increases visa fees

Dhaka, June 19: The United States has increased application fees for certain nonimmigrant visas (NIVs), including travel, business, and temporary workers. On Sunday, the Facebook page of the United States Embassy in Dhaka informed about the increase in visa fees. The new visa fee came into effect from Saturday.

Neither the Awami League nor the government is afraid of the new US visa policy: Obaidul Quader

Dhaka, June 6: Awami League General Secretary and Road Transport and Bridges Minister Obaidul Quader said that Awami League and the government are not afraid of the new visa policy of the United States, as they always respect the constitution, democracy, human rights and the rule of law.

Sheikh Hasina is not worried about visa policy: Obaidul Quader

Dhaka, May 28: General Secretary of Awami League and Minister of Road Transport and Bridges Obaidul Quader said that the government is not worried about the US visa policy. He said, "We will make the elections fair, free and neutral. We have set a bright example in Gazipur. Therefore, Sheikh Hasina does not have to worry about who outside banned, stopped visas."

IGP Benazir Ahmed gets US visa

Dhaka, August 25: Inspector General of Police (IGP) Dr. Benazir Ahmed is going to the United States to attend the United Nations Police Summit. However, he has been granted a visa on the condition that he does not go to any other event outside the United Nations program. On Thursday (August 25), sources from the police headquarters and the home ministry confirmed that he had received the visa.
